The typical Bowie goes back to work and fighting knives from the time of the legendary Wild West in 1800. The name comes from James Bowie, a pioneer and soldier in Texas. He made these knife shape famous. Typically are the duckbill shaped blade and the strong, often S-shaped guard. The blade of stainless molybdenum vanadium steel is a round tang to the handle end and is screwed there.

The handle is made of Pakkawood and has pronounced finger grooves for a good grip, the guard and the pommel are made from brass. With high quality leather sheath.

Details:
Overall length: approx. 27 cm
Blade length: approx. 15.5 cm
Blade Material: Molybdenum-Vanadium steel
Handle Material: Pakkawood
